Bangladesh Telecommunications Company Limited (BTCL)

Project: Replacement of Old Digital Telephone System of Dhaka City (RODTS)

v    Project’s important events :

 

*     Project Approval Date: 19 July 2009 (18th BOD Meeting).

 

*     Project Duration: September 2009 to August 2011.

 

*     Project Started: 04 October 2009.

   

*     Project Cost : Total= 19,663.19 lac taka                                    

                           (Including Foreign Currency= 9,067.55 lac taka)

 

*     Source of Fund: BTCL own fund.

 

 

*     Tender for Imported Equipments:

 

       Floated: 15 November 2009

       Opened:  3 March 2010

       Evaluation of Bids is going on.

 

*     Tender for OSP works :

 

       Floated: 12 November 2009

       Opened: 24 February 2010

       Evaluation of Bids is going on.

 

 

v    Purpose of the project:

 

*      Replace some of the old digital telephone exchanges of Dhaka City.

 

*      Avoid using copper cable as much as possible and extend fibre optic cable up to the customer premises i.e. building or even to the home (FTTB or FTTH). Optical fibre is less costly than that of copper cable and its maintenance is easy with less chance of stolen/disturbed by other service providers. Optical fibre offers a huge bandwidth with which BTCL will be able to offer voice, video and data service (Internet) simultaneously with a single pair of cable.

Introduce NGN (Next Generation Network)  based  architecture to facilitate IP (Internet Protocol) based node/end user identification  with QoS (Quality of Service) enabled, which means customer will enjoy  services “ as you pay” basis : better services at an affordable price . It is possible for the customer to achieve more value for their money with graded service quality: pay more for better service.

 

 

v     Within the scope of the project BTCL has taken plan to install:

 

 

*     Two Soft Switches to be operated at hot standby mode, one to be  installed at  Sher-E-Bangla Nagar Telephone Exchange building  and another at Ramna Telephone Exchange building, Dhaka. Soft Switch acts as the Media Gateway Controller.

 

*     Seven Trunk Gateways (TGWs) at SB Nagar, Ramna, Nilkhet,Moghbazar, Gulshan, Mirpur and Uttara Telephone Exchange Buildings. TGWs will be used to connect with other existing or forthcoming digital exchanges (circuit switched or packet switched). 

  

*     188 (one hundred and eighty eight) Access Gateway (AGW) will be installed in different places of Dhaka city of different equipped capacities. AGWs will be used to connect customers and be located near to the customer’s premises.

 

*     7(Seven) GPON OLTE (Gigabit Passive Optical Network, Optical Line Terminating Equipment) one per TGW site. GPON OLTEs will be used to extend FTTH or FTTB facility.

 

 

v    Present Position of the Project:

 

*     Two separate tenders to procure imported Equipments and OSP works have already been floated. Evaluations of both the tenders are going  on .
